none
ajuda RRS feed

  • Pergunta

  • Bom Dia a todos,

    Queria saber o seguinte, tenho um banco de dados em access, 1º form é frmPrincipal, queria que ao clicar no button Abrirno frmPrincipal ja add uma nova linha no 2º form sem precisar clicar no bindingNavigatorAddNewItem na barra AbrirBindingNavigator do 2º frm, tipo ao clicar neste button ja add automaticamente no 2º form as linhas para digitar,

    fiz assim

    private void button1_Click(object sender, EventArgs e)
            {
                bindingNavigatorAddNewItem.PerformClick();

    so que add o id masi so salva no 1º id, o 2º e 3 assim sucessivamente ñ preenche nada

    so salva no 1º

    deste ja agradeço a quem poder ajudar

    quarta-feira, 13 de fevereiro de 2013 12:56

Respostas

  • sugiro que você faça um método publico que adicione as linhas, com os seus valores padrões

    e apartir disso você pode chamar eles de qualquer lugar... mesmo estando em formulários diferentes...

    tipo 

    public void AddNewLine()

    {

    //seu código

    }

    depois

    FormSecundario frm = new FormSecundario();

    frm.AddNewLine();

    tente assim =D

    • Marcado como Resposta JMarcelocs quarta-feira, 13 de fevereiro de 2013 14:10
    quarta-feira, 13 de fevereiro de 2013 13:08
  • SO UMA DEMOSTRAÇAO DO QUE ESTA ACONTECENDO, DEU CERTO O CODIGO MAIS TA CRIANDO SO O ID E SO SALVA NO 1º ID O RESTO FICA EM BRANCO

    QUERIA QUE IA SALVANDO SEMPRE NO ULTIMO ID

    SE ALGUEM PUDER ME ENSINAR E COMO FICAREI GRATO

    ID        CAIXA       VALOR TOTAL

    1           2.50              2.50

    2                                   

    3

    CONSEGUI COLCANDO O CODIGO  ASSIM

     private void caixaInicialMaskedTextBox_Enter(object sender, EventArgs e)
            {
                bindingNavigatorAddNewItem.PerformClick();
            }

    • Marcado como Resposta JMarcelocs sábado, 23 de fevereiro de 2013 15:02
    segunda-feira, 18 de fevereiro de 2013 23:36

Todas as Respostas

  • sugiro que você faça um método publico que adicione as linhas, com os seus valores padrões

    e apartir disso você pode chamar eles de qualquer lugar... mesmo estando em formulários diferentes...

    tipo 

    public void AddNewLine()

    {

    //seu código

    }

    depois

    FormSecundario frm = new FormSecundario();

    frm.AddNewLine();

    tente assim =D

    • Marcado como Resposta JMarcelocs quarta-feira, 13 de fevereiro de 2013 14:10
    quarta-feira, 13 de fevereiro de 2013 13:08
  • EU ESTOU COMEÇANDO AGORA E TENTEI FAZER MAIS OU MENOS COMO ME EXPLICOU, MAIS Ñ CONSEGUI

    ESSE CODIGO VAI NO 2º FORME

    FormSecundario frm = new FormSecundario();

    frm.AddNewLine();

    quarta-feira, 13 de fevereiro de 2013 18:50
  • o método AddNewLine fica no form 2 a criação dele e talz..

    já a chamada do método fica no form 1

    quarta-feira, 13 de fevereiro de 2013 18:58
  • SO UMA DEMOSTRAÇAO DO QUE ESTA ACONTECENDO, DEU CERTO O CODIGO MAIS TA CRIANDO SO O ID E SO SALVA NO 1º ID O RESTO FICA EM BRANCO

    QUERIA QUE IA SALVANDO SEMPRE NO ULTIMO ID

    SE ALGUEM PUDER ME ENSINAR E COMO FICAREI GRATO

    ID        CAIXA       VALOR TOTAL

    1           2.50              2.50

    2                                   

    3

    domingo, 17 de fevereiro de 2013 19:30
  • SO UMA DEMOSTRAÇAO DO QUE ESTA ACONTECENDO, DEU CERTO O CODIGO MAIS TA CRIANDO SO O ID E SO SALVA NO 1º ID O RESTO FICA EM BRANCO

    QUERIA QUE IA SALVANDO SEMPRE NO ULTIMO ID

    SE ALGUEM PUDER ME ENSINAR E COMO FICAREI GRATO

    ID        CAIXA       VALOR TOTAL

    1           2.50              2.50

    2                                   

    3

    CONSEGUI COLCANDO O CODIGO  ASSIM

     private void caixaInicialMaskedTextBox_Enter(object sender, EventArgs e)
            {
                bindingNavigatorAddNewItem.PerformClick();
            }

    • Marcado como Resposta JMarcelocs sábado, 23 de fevereiro de 2013 15:02
    segunda-feira, 18 de fevereiro de 2013 23:36